Hi guys, i was contacted by 2 different farmers last week about 5 gyros flying very low over there farms. The one complaint came from the north of Upington and the same day from a farm to the east.

The one farmer to the east said that some of his springbuck ran through wires as one of the gyros, yellow one was flying less than 50ft agl.

I did see the gyros land at Upington and depart again about 2pm.

Guys i know low flying is nice but please the kalahari also have wires and some farms with animals. We are not doing ourselves and our sport any favors in doing this.
